KeywordsBitcoin, AI, quantum computing, mining efficiency, innovation, blockchain, technology, silicon, algorithms, researchSummaryThe conversation delves into the intersection of Bitcoin mining, AI, and quantum computing, highlighting the challenges and innovations in improving mining efficiency. The panelists, comprising experts from various fields, discuss their backgrounds, the technological advancements they are working on, and the implications for the Bitcoin industry. They emphasize the importance of collaboration between academia and the mining community to bridge the gap between theoretical advancements and practical applications. The discussion also touches on the need for standards and regulations in the evolving crypto landscape.TakeawaysThe Bitcoin mining industry faces a significant gap between academic innovation and practical application.Efficiency improvements in Bitcoin mining can lead to substantial gains, estimated at 30-50%.Quantum computing presents both challenges and opportunities for enhancing SHA-256 algorithms.Collaboration between engineers and miners is crucial for advancing technology in the Bitcoin space.The development of AI models can help predict mining outcomes and improve efficiency.Patents are being filed for new algorithms that could revolutionize Bitcoin mining.The integration of new technologies into existing mining hardware is a complex process.Open source initiatives are vital for the long-term success of the Bitcoin ecosystem.Standards in the industry can help drive innovation and adoption of new technologies.The future of Bitcoin mining will depend on both corporate investment and grassroots innovation.Chapters00:00 Setting the Stage for Innovation in Bitcoin Mining02:10 Introduction of Key Innovators and Their Backgrounds05:36 Exploring Efficiency Improvements in SHA-25610:11 Bridging the Gap Between Theory and Application18:24 Next Steps in Implementing New Technologies24:11 Reflections on Industry Impact and Future Directions
